The time went by and finally back at the house in fall. “Fall”, which I think refers to the family’s situation also (mentally, physically, and economically). Just like in fall all the leaves fall, grass turns brown, and sign of winter, snow the bad time of year comes. I think the family’s situation was very similar to it. I think this novel has connection with everything. Just like fall, the family was all broken/fallen by all the bad times they had to go through. Coming back for them was very fortunate, but at the same time for society they were not respected people at all. They had lost their identity, marked people, and they were very mentally disturbed also. They were not considered in high/mid level society at all. When they tried to get friendly with those same people who were nice to them, they would also ignore them. “Now when we ran into these same people on the street they turned away and pretended not to see us”(115). I think society should help them come out of their grief, but they wouldn’t because of arrogance. I think this family is very brave. They still have hopes and they are trying to get over with their past and move on with their life leaving the past behind. They are not thinking about what they lost, but what they have to gain. They are happy to be home. They feel that they are lucky that they have home to come back to, because there are a lot of other people who had nowhere to go. “Many people who had come back with us on the train had no homes to return to at all”(109). They know that their house is not in good condition, but still they have a hope that they will make their house just like it was before. They will sleep on separate beds all alone and they will have good food to eat. They will go back to school and make up for the years they have missed. They will dress like other students and they’ll change their name. They will have good food to eat again. Their mother started to work at other’s houses and bought her children new dress, house things, and good food, etc. She even worked when she had a day off to get some extra money for her family. “On her days off she took in washing and ironing to make a few extra dollars” (129). I think their mother is the bravest character in this novel. Because even being mentally and physically, and economically disturbed (cheated by Milt Parker), she didn’t give up. She tried her best to give her children the best life she can. When they came back home, there was hardly anything left in it, but still by working hard she bought the things that they needed to live. I think this family is very strong. I also think that in some way it’s a happy ending story. This family has high hopes. They know how to leave the past behind and look for good future. I think moving on in life is the only way to have a better life and this family has proven that. They are moving on with a lot of hopes, which is the only way one can come out of his grieves. I think this story is very powerful for the readers who are also emotionally and physically disturbed. It can be a good way for them to find a right path and move on with their lives. I think Julie Otsuka has done a great job writing this novel.
